I have the various designs as: T70/Bonded Shaving System Design 1 – Grey. Design 2 – Black with metal strip along the body of the handle. Design 3 – In Black and White, similar to T70 Design 2. T70 Design 1 – T70 with red dot. Design 2 – T70 Black with flat head and metal strip along the body of the handle. Design 3 – T70 with metal pin on head. There could be more... Great haul! Your Old Spice mug is a Hull Potery either the 02 or 03. The Mug 02 was made from 1941-44 and has within a rope circle on the bottom the words "Old Spice," "Shaving Soap," and "USA." The Mug 03 from 1944 to the early 1950s, has "Old Spice" incised across the middle of the rope ring and "Made in USA" is in an outer ring. Outside of that they are identical and have "Ship Friendship" on the front. Just in case your interested the Mug 01 has the "Ship Grand Turk" on the front and was made from 1938-41.
